im网站如何实现数据可视化展示?

在当今数字化时代,数据可视化已成为信息传递和展示的重要手段。IM(即时通讯)网站作为日常生活中不可或缺的交流平台,如何实现数据可视化展示,不仅能够提升用户体验,还能帮助网站运营者更好地分析用户行为和网站运营效果。以下将从几个方面详细探讨IM网站如何实现数据可视化展示。

一、数据收集与处理

  1. 数据来源

IM网站的数据可视化展示需要从多个渠道收集数据,包括用户行为数据、网站运营数据、社交媒体数据等。以下是一些常见的数据来源:

(1)用户行为数据:如登录时间、在线时长、消息发送量、好友数量等。

(2)网站运营数据:如网站流量、页面浏览量、用户活跃度等。

(3)社交媒体数据:如微博、微信等社交媒体平台上关于IM网站的相关讨论和评论。


  1. 数据处理

收集到的原始数据通常需要进行清洗、整合和转换,以便于后续的数据可视化展示。以下是数据处理的一些常见步骤:

(1)数据清洗:去除重复、缺失、异常等无效数据。

(2)数据整合:将不同来源的数据进行合并,形成统一的数据集。

(3)数据转换:将原始数据转换为适合可视化展示的格式,如时间序列、图表数据等。

二、数据可视化工具

  1. 常见可视化工具

目前,市面上有很多数据可视化工具,以下是一些常用的工具:

(1)Excel:适用于简单的数据可视化展示,如柱状图、折线图等。

(2)Tableau:功能强大的数据可视化工具,支持多种图表类型和交互功能。

(3)Power BI:由微软开发的数据可视化工具,与Office 365等软件集成良好。

(4)Python可视化库:如Matplotlib、Seaborn等,适用于开发定制化的数据可视化应用。


  1. 选择合适的工具

在选择数据可视化工具时,需要考虑以下因素:

(1)数据量:对于大数据量的可视化展示,选择功能强大的工具更为合适。

(2)图表类型:根据数据特点和展示需求,选择合适的图表类型。

(3)交互性:如果需要实现用户与数据的交互,选择支持交互功能的工具。

三、数据可视化展示

  1. 用户行为数据可视化

(1)用户活跃度:通过柱状图、折线图等展示用户在线时长、消息发送量等指标。

(2)用户增长趋势:通过折线图展示用户数量、活跃用户数量等指标随时间的变化。

(3)用户分布:通过地图、饼图等展示用户地域分布、年龄分布等。


  1. 网站运营数据可视化

(1)网站流量:通过柱状图、折线图等展示网站访问量、页面浏览量等指标。

(2)用户留存率:通过折线图展示用户留存率随时间的变化。

(3)转化率:通过柱状图、折线图等展示注册用户、付费用户等指标。


  1. 社交媒体数据可视化

(1)社交媒体话题热度:通过词云、柱状图等展示热门话题。

(2)社交媒体用户评价:通过情感分析、饼图等展示用户评价的正面、负面比例。

四、总结

IM网站数据可视化展示是提升用户体验、优化网站运营的重要手段。通过收集、处理和展示数据,可以帮助网站运营者更好地了解用户行为和网站运营效果。在实际应用中,需要根据数据特点和展示需求,选择合适的工具和图表类型,实现数据可视化展示。

猜你喜欢:语音通话sdk